Global ATV Drivetrain System Market (USD Million), 2021 - 2031
In the year 2024, the Global ATV Drivetrain System Market was valued at USD 1089.21 million. The size of this market is expected to increase to USD 1532.62 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 5.0%.
The global ATV drivetrain system market is witnessing steady growth, driven by the increasing demand for all-terrain vehicles (ATVs) across various applications, including recreational, agricultural, and industrial. The drivetrain system is a critical component of ATVs, responsible for transferring power from the engine to the wheels and ensuring optimal performance and maneuverability in diverse terrain conditions. As the popularity of ATVs continues to rise worldwide, fueled by recreational pursuits and utility applications, there is a parallel increase in the demand for reliable and durable drivetrain systems that can withstand the rigors of off-road use.

Global ATV Drivetrain System Market Recent Developments
-
In February 2023, Polaris introduced a reinforced drivetrain system for its high-performance ATVs, aimed at reducing maintenance and improving durability under extreme conditions.
-
In August 2022, Yamaha Motor announced upgrades to its ATV drivetrains, incorporating innovative materials to increase torque efficiency and vehicle longevity.

Global ATV Drivetrain System Market, Segmentation by Application
The Global ATV Drivetrain System Market has been segmented by Application into Utility ATV and Sport ATV.
The segmentation of the global ATV drivetrain system market by application into Utility ATV and Sport ATV reflects the diverse uses and requirements of these vehicles. Utility ATVs are primarily designed for practical purposes such as agriculture, forestry, landscaping, and utility maintenance. The drivetrain systems in utility ATVs are engineered to provide robust performance and durability in demanding work environments. These vehicles often feature selectable 4WD systems, differential locks, and high-torque engines to tackle challenging terrain and heavy-duty tasks efficiently.
In contrast, Sport ATVs are optimized for recreational riding and competitive motorsports, offering high-performance drivetrain systems tailored for speed, agility, and maneuverability. The drivetrains in sport ATVs prioritize acceleration, handling, and traction control, allowing riders to navigate rough trails, jumps, and corners with precision and confidence. Advanced features such as electronic power steering, sport-tuned suspension systems, and responsive throttle control contribute to the dynamic performance of sport ATVs, enhancing the riding experience for enthusiasts and professional riders alike.

Shift towards Electric and Hybrid Drivetrains-The global ATV drivetrain system market is witnessing a significant shift towards electric and hybrid drivetrains, driven by the growing emphasis on sustainability and the adoption of clean energy solutions in the automotive industry. Electric and hybrid drivetrains offer several advantages over traditional internal combustion engines, including reduced emissions, quieter operation, and lower operating costs. In response to increasing environmental concerns and stringent regulations aimed at curbing greenhouse gas emissions, manufacturers are investing in the development of electric and hybrid ATV drivetrain systems to meet the evolving needs of consumers and regulatory requirements.
Technological advancements in battery technology and electric powertrains are driving the feasibility and performance of electric and hybrid ATV drivetrains. Improvements in battery energy density, charging infrastructure, and motor efficiency have significantly enhanced the range, power output, and overall performance of electric ATVs. Similarly, advancements in hybrid drivetrain systems, which combine internal combustion engines with electric motors and batteries, offer the benefits of both power sources, including improved fuel efficiency and extended range. As a result, electric and hybrid ATV drivetrains are becoming increasingly competitive with traditional gasoline-powered systems, driving their adoption across various applications.
